André Amorim

Crafting Web Experiences

//

If Condition Types in Bash

Multi Line:

if [[ $INSTALLED != "yes" ]]; then
	echo "Error message."
fi
if [[ $INSTALLED != "yes" ]]; then
	echo "Error message."
else
	echo "Message."
fi

One Line:

if [[ $INSTALLED != "yes" ]];then echo "Error message."; fi
if [[ $INSTALLED != "yes" ]];then echo "Error message."; else echo "Message."; fi

Another One Line Method:

[[ $INSTALLED != "yes" ]] && echo "Error message." || sleep 0
[[ $INSTALLED != "yes" ]] && echo "Error message." || echo "Message."

Published date:

Modified date: